Rubber (EPDM) Roof Repair

Deer Park Roofing, Inc. was contracted to perform maintenance to this commercial property located in downtown Cincinnati. The first photo shows the Rubber (EPDM) ballasted by concrete pavers. The roof had several leaks and was in need of repair.

The lack of maintenance over a 15 year period was the contributing factor for the roof leaks. As the roof pavers deteriorated, foot traffic caused punctures to the single ply EPDM. The property manager did not wish to replace the rubber membrane and asked for a solution that was within their roofing budget.

Our roof mechanics first removed the concrete pavers and identified several areas in need of repair. The roof was then cleaned and primed for the installation of new roof flashing and EPDM patches to the existing rubber roof system. Metal anchor bar was installed to replace the ballasted pavers.

New flashing was installed to all HVAC curbs and EPDM cover tape was installed over the anchor bar. All roof penetrations were either repaired or replaced. Debris was removed from the roof drains to eliminate ponding water.

After the repair work was completed, new lightweight EPDM roof pavers were installed. The roof system was guaranteed to be free from leaks for a period of five years.
